Lenovo has announced the IdeaPad 1 in India, the company's first laptop with the Ryzen 3 7320U . The company says that the laptop is the perfect balance of performance, productivity, and responsiveness, ideal for students, teachers, and working professionals.
The IdeaPad 1 features a 15-inch FHD anti-glare display offering 220 nits of brightness. Furthermore, the laptop has a stereo speaker setup with Dolby Audio. The laptop includes an in-built 720p HD camera and comes with a physical privacy shutter.
Powered by AMD Ryzen 3 7320U, the IdeaPad 1 comes with Radeon 610M integrated graphics. Further, the laptop comes with 8GB of RAM and 512GB of M2 PCIe 4.0 SSD, upgradable up to 1TB. The company offers up to 14 hours of battery life.
The laptop comes with support for WiFi 6 connectivity. As for ports, the laptop has a USB 2.0, a USB 3.2 Gen 1, a USB-C 3.2 Gen 1, an HDMI 1.4, a Card reader, and a 3.5mm headphone/microphone combo jack.
